Long read sequencing is used to analysis of genetic disorders that the disease loci are either strongly suspected or previously known.

Long-read sequencing technologies have the potential to beat specific limitations related to next-generation sequencing-based investigations of clinical disorders. The utilization of longer reads that originate from one DNA particle provides an advantage to long-read sequencing methods over their corresponding person.
